New satellite centre aims to combat global cyber attack threat

The facility at Heriot-Watt uses laser technology to identify potential incidents

A cutting-edge £2.5m facility that will help secure next-generation communications against cyber threats has opened near Edinburgh.

The Quantum Communications Hub Optical Ground Station at Heriot-Watt University sees advanced laser technology to communicate with satellites in ways that could make data breaches a thing of the past.
